SAN DIEGO – Not long after the news broke Tuesday night that Brewers star Christian Yelich is out for the season with a broken kneecap, Kris Bryant hit a pair of two-run homers for the Cubs in his return from his own knee injury.
Which knee has a bigger impact on either team remains to be seen over the final 20 days of the season.
What’s certain is that the National League playoff picture took on a much different look Tuesday night.
Yelich, the reigning NL MVP, was having an even better season this year – including a 6-for-8, five-walk surge against the Cubs in three consecutive Brewer victories over the weekend.
